Ore no Imouto’s second run has been confirmed for a debut of April 2013, the season of spring – and the production responsibilities, for better or worse, have been switched over to the highly questionable A-1 Pictures.

This series isn’t looking too bright on the horizon – those familiar with Ore no Imouto’s light novel series know that it devolves into a typical harem entering the highschool timeline and onward from there, and one can already see that the recent marketing for this series has been suspiciously more so salacious than the norm. And now, another reason to worry for the worst, production has shifted – which not only is nearly always a troubling detail, but A-1 Pictures in particular isn’t looking too impressive at the moment.

It seems that 2013 won’t be a good year for the imouto.
